什么是HTtps代理IP?
HTTPS代理IP是指通过HTTPS协议进行通信的代理服务器,它可以在客户端和目标服务器之间建立一个安全的通道,实现数据加密传输,HTTPS代理IP的主要作用是保护用户的隐私和数据安全,防止数据在传输过程中被窃取或篡改。
HTTPS代理IP的使用流程
1、获取HTTPS代理IP:用户可以通过各种途径获取HTTPS代理IP,如购买代理服务、使用免费代理池等,获取到的代理IP需要进行验证,确保其有效性和安全性。
2、配置代理设置:在客户端设备上配置代理服务器的地址和端口,将HTTP请求发送到代理服务器,由代理服务器转发给目标服务器,这样,客户端就可以通过代理服务器访问互联网,隐藏自己的真实IP地址。
3、验证代理服务器:在使用HTTPS代理IP时,需要对代理服务器进行验证,确保其有效性,验证方法包括:检查代理服务器是否能够正常响应请求、检查代理服务器是否支持HTTPS协议等。
4、测试代理服务器:在配置好代理设置后,可以尝试访问一些网站或发送一些请求,以测试代理服务器是否正常工作,如果出现问题,需要重新配置代理设置或更换代理服务器。
5、断开代理服务器:当不再需要使用HTTPS代理IP时,需要断开与代理服务器的连接,这可以通过关闭客户端设备的网络连接或修改代理设置来实现。
HTTPS代理IP的优势
1、提高访问速度:通过使用HTTPS代理IP,可以绕过网络拥堵和地域限制,提高访问速度,由于数据经过加密传输,还可以避免因网络不稳定导致的数据丢失。
2、保护隐私:HTTPS代理IP可以隐藏用户的真实IP地址,保护用户的隐私不被泄露,通过使用HTTPS协议进行通信,还可以防止数据在传输过程中被窃取或篡改。
3、支持多种应用:HTTPS代理IP不仅可以用于浏览器访问网页,还可以用于各种应用程序的数据传输,如P2P下载、在线游戏等。
4、灵活性高:用户可以根据实际需求选择不同类型的HTTPS代理IP,如匿名代理、高匿代理等,以满足不同的使用场景。
相关问题与解答
1、如何判断一个HTTPS代理IP是否有效?
答:可以通过发送一个简单的HTTP请求到代理服务器,观察其响应情况来判断代理服务器是否有效,如果能够正常响应请求且返回的数据与预期一致,则说明该代理服务器有效,还可以通过检查代理服务器的IP地址、端口号等信息来确认其真实性。
2、如何使用Python设置HTTPS代理IP?
答:可以使用requests库来设置HTTPS代理IP,示例代码如下:
import requestsproxies = { 'http': 'http://your_proxy_ip:your_proxy_port', 'https': 'https://your_proxy_ip:your_proxy_port',}response = requests.get('http://example.com', proxies=proxies)print(response.text)
3、HTTPS代理IP是否会影响网络安全?
答:虽然HTTPS代理IP可以提高访问速度和保护隐私,但如果使用不当,仍然可能存在一定的安全隐患,如果代理服务器本身存在安全漏洞,或者用户使用的是已经被感染的恶意软件生成的代理IP,都可能导致网络安全风险,在使用HTTPS代理IP时,需要选择信誉良好的服务商提供的代理服务,并定期更新系统和软件以防范安全风险。